Bamboo: The Sustainable Giant

Bamboo has gained popularity as a renewable building material due to its rapid growth rate and impressive strength. It is often referred to as nature’s “green steel” for its durability and flexibility. Bamboo can be used in flooring, walls, and structural components, providing a rustic yet modern aesthetic. Its ability to regenerate quickly after harvesting makes it an ideal choice for sustainable construction projects, ensuring a minimal ecological footprint.

Innovative Natural Insulation

Sheep’s wool is an excellent natural insulator that outperforms many synthetic alternatives. Its ability to regulate humidity and resist flame makes it a safe and efficient choice for modern buildings. As a renewable resource, wool is biodegradable and requires minimal processing, translating to reduced energy consumption. Its integration into construction reflects a commitment to both comfort and eco-friendliness.
Hempcrete is a lightweight material made from the hemp plant combined with lime. It acts as a natural insulator and is highly breathable, helping to regulate temperatures and prevent moisture buildup. Hempcrete is not only effective in insulation but also contributes to carbon sequestration, making it a powerhouse in eco-friendly construction. It offers a way to achieve energy efficiency while staying true to sustainable principles.
Cork is harvested from the bark of cork oak trees without harming the tree, making it a sustainable material. Its excellent insulating properties and sound absorption capabilities make it a versatile choice for flooring and wall coverings. Cork is also naturally resistant to mold, mildew, and pests, providing an eco-friendly solution that enhances both comfort and indoor air quality in modern designs.

Environmentally Conscious Concrete Alternatives

Fly Ash Concrete: A Waste-Reducing Innovation

Fly ash concrete uses coal combustion byproduct fly ash, reducing the need for cement in concrete mixtures. This not only recycles waste materials but also decreases greenhouse gas emissions associated with traditional concrete production. Fly ash concrete offers robustness and longevity, allowing builders to create structures that marry modern design with environmental mindfulness.

Green Concrete: The Sustainable Mix

Green concrete incorporates recycled materials and industrial waste, minimizing the reliance on natural resources. By replacing a portion of the cement with materials such as slag or silica fume, builders can achieve a reduction in carbon emissions. Green concrete is evidence that sustainable practices can result in durable and high-performing modern structures, setting a benchmark for future construction methods.

Ferrock: A Carbon-Negative Marvel

Ferrock is a cutting-edge material made from recycled steel dust and silica. It absorbs carbon dioxide during its curing process, making it a carbon-negative alternative to traditional concrete. Its immense strength and resistance to corrosion are ideal for modern designs that demand sustainability without compromising on durability. Ferrock represents a pioneering move towards greener building practices, showcasing innovation and commitment to the environment.
